In 1955 Robert Stine wanted to photograph the non-Hollywood version of Marilyn Monroe so they tamed Norma Jean's curls, put on an overcoat and no one seemed to notice as she road the NY City subway. When they returned to the station and walked back up to the streets of NY, Norma Jean turned to the photographers and said, "Do you want to see her?"....& what they saw made them speechless.

  • Today's episode draws Todd Herman's book "The Alter Ego Effect," & speaks to the power of your Alter Ego.
  • We all have an Alter Ego.
  • & why you're afraid to use it...and should use it more.
